Understanding Soil Depth

Soil depth refers to the distance from the surface of the ground to the underlying bedrock or hardpan layer. It can vary widely across different regions and landscapes, ranging from a few inches in rocky areas to several feet in fertile plains. Soil depth is influenced by geological processes, weathering, erosion, and organic matter accumulation over time.

In the context of camping, soil depth can be categorized into three general types:

  1. Shallow Soil: Typically less than 12 inches deep, shallow soil often has limited capacity for supporting vegetation and can lead to rapid drainage.

  2. Moderate Soil: Ranging from 12 to 36 inches deep, moderate soil provides a balance between drainage and nutrient availability, fostering varied plant life.

  3. Deep Soil: Exceeding 36 inches in depth, deep soil is generally rich in nutrients and moisture-retaining capacity, supporting diverse ecosystems.

Each type of soil depth brings its unique features that can greatly influence the camping experience.

Vegetation and Ecosystem Diversity

One of the most noticeable impacts of varying soil depths is on the type and density of vegetation present in an area.

Shallow Soil Campsites

Campsites with shallow soil often feature sparse vegetation due to limited nutrient availability and water retention. The types of plants that thrive in these areas tend to be hardy species that can withstand harsh conditions, such as droughts or rocky terrains. Examples might include scrub brush or low-growing herbs.

While these sites may offer stunning views or unique rock formations, they often have limited shade from trees or shrubs. Consequently, campers may find themselves exposed to the elements—direct sunlight during the day or colder temperatures at night—making it vital to bring adequate gear for protection.

Moderate Soil Campsites

Moderate soil depths strike a balance between supporting plant life and providing adequate drainage. These areas typically host a diverse array of vegetation including grasses, wildflowers, shrubs, and young trees. This diversity can enhance the camping experience by offering natural beauty, wildlife viewing opportunities, and even edible plants for foraging enthusiasts.

Campsites situated in moderate soil zones often provide better insulation and protection from wind due to tree cover. The presence of more developed root systems helps stabilize the ground as well, reducing the likelihood of erosion or landslides near tent sites.

Deep Soil Campsites

Deep soils are usually found in lowland areas or river valleys where sediment has accumulated over time. These regions support lush forests or dense underbrush that attract various wildlife species. Campers can enjoy shaded environments with ample opportunities for exploration.

The rich nutrient content in deep soils fosters a broad range of flora and fauna which enhances biodiversity. However, these campsites may also pose challenges such as increased insect populations (mosquitoes and ticks) or muddy conditions following rainfall.

Water Management and Drainage

Proper water management is essential for camping comfort and safety. Soil depth directly affects drainage capabilities which influence how water interacts with the landscape.

Shallow Soil Drainage

Shallow soils tend to drain quickly due to their limited capacity for retaining moisture. While this can be beneficial during dry periods—keeping tents dry—it can also lead to issues such as rapid runoff during heavy rains since there’s less soil to absorb the water. Campers at shallow soil sites should be wary of flash floods or pooling water near their campsites.

Moderate Soil Drainage

Moderate soils provide improved drainage compared to shallow soils while still retaining enough moisture to support vegetation growth. This balance makes them ideal for camping as campers experience fewer issues with standing water or overly saturated grounds after rainfall.

Moreover, moderate soils facilitate natural filtration processes that improve water quality—essential for campers relying on nearby creeks or lakes for drinking water after proper purification methods.

Deep Soil Drainage

Deep soils have excellent water retention capabilities; however, they may become saturated during prolonged rain events. While this makes them ripe for flourishing plant life, it can also lead to muddy conditions that complicate camping activities such as setting up tents or cooking outdoors.

Campers should assess drainage patterns when choosing deep soil sites—look for elevated ground that reduces flood risk while still providing access to essential resources like water sources without compromising tent stability.

Ground Stability and Tent Setup

Soil depth influences ground stability—a vital consideration when selecting a campsite suitable for pitching tents securely and safely.

Shallow Soil Stability

Shallow soils are often compromised by their rocky composition or loose topsoil that lacks cohesion. Campers may face challenges securing stakes into these sites; tents may shift or collapse if not anchored effectively. Moreover, any nearby slopes could pose risks for landslides if significant rainfall occurs post-setup.

Moderate Soil Stability

Moderate soils generally offer balanced stability suitable for tent setups while providing decent anchoring ability for tent stakes without excessive effort required. They present fewer risks associated with erosion compared to shallow sites; however, campers should still assess surrounding grades before making their selection.

Deep Soil Stability

Deep soils provide exceptional stability owing largely due to their cohesive root systems created by extensive vegetation growth above them. These campsites can withstand varied weather conditions while keeping tents securely anchored against winds—even during storms!

Nevertheless, attention must remain focused on potential hazards like falling branches from nearby trees (known as widow-makers). Always scout your surroundings before settling down!
